Zusammenfassung
Benutzer benötigen eine Möglichkeit zum Erkennen von Problemen, die bei der Behandlung von Problemen oder beim Durchführen von Diagnosen im Zusammenhang mit einer Enterprise-Geodatabase auf der Client-Seite der Datenbankverbindung auftreten. Die SDEINTERCEPT-Protokolldatei enthält ausführliche Informationen und Datensätze zu den durchgeführten Transaktionen sowie zu den damit verbundenen Fehlern.
Weitere Informationen zur Funktionsweise der SDEINTERCEPT-Protokolldatei finden Sie im Esri Knowledge Base-Artikel How To: Diagnose ArcSDE connection and performance issues using SDEINTERCEPT.
Vorgehensweise
In den folgenden Anweisungen wird beschrieben, wie die SDEINTERCEPT-Protokolldatei auf einem Client-Computer für ArcGIS Desktop und ArcGIS Server eingerichtet wird.
ArcGIS Desktop
- Klicken Sie auf Start. Klicken Sie anschließend mit der rechten Maustaste auf Arbeitsplatz. Klicken Sie dann auf Eigenschaften > Erweiterte Systemeinstellungen.
- Klicken Sie im Fenster Systemeigenschaften auf die Registerkarte Erweitert, und wählen Sie Umgebungsvariablen aus.
- Klicken Sie unter Systemvariable auf Neu, und geben Sie in den jeweiligen Feldern Folgendes ein:
- Geben Sie für Variablenname den Namen sdeintercept ein.
- Geben Sie für Variablenwert den Wert crwTf ein.
- Klicken Sie auf OK.
- Wiederholen Sie zum Erstellen einer neuen Variablen Schritt 3:
Hinweis: Stellen Sie vor dem Erstellen der Variablen sicher, dass das Zielverzeichnis und der Ordner vorhanden sind.
- Geben Sie für Variablenname den Namen sdeinterceptloc ein.
- Geben Sie für den Variablenwert den Wert C:\temp\sde_client ein.
- Klicken Sie auf OK, und schließen Sie die Fenster Systemeigenschaften und Erweiterte Systemeinstellungen.
- Reproduzieren Sie den Fehler oder das Problem.
- Navigieren Sie zu dem in Schritt 4 (ii) angegebenen Verzeichnis, und überprüfen Sie die erstellten sde_client-Dateien.
- Wiederholen Sie nach Abschluss dieser Diagnose die Schritte 1 und 2, und löschen Sie die in den Schritten 3 und 4 erstellten Variablen in der Liste Systemvariable.
ArcGIS Server
- Klicken Sie auf Start. Klicken Sie anschließend mit der rechten Maustaste aufArbeitsplatz. Klicken Sie dann auf Eigenschaften > Erweiterte Systemeinstellungen.
- Klicken Sie im Fenster Systemeigenschaften auf die Registerkarte Erweitert, und wählen Sie Umgebungsvariablen aus.
- Klicken Sie unter Systemvariable aufNeu, und geben Sie in den jeweiligen Feldern Folgendes ein:
- Geben Sie für Variablenname den Namen sdeintercept ein.
- Geben Sie für Variablenwert den Wert crwTf ein.
- Klicken Sie auf OK.
- Wiederholen Sie zum Erstellen einer neuen Variablen Schritt 3:
Hinweis: Stellen Sie vor dem Erstellen der Variablen sicher, dass das Zielverzeichnis und der Ordner vorhanden sind und dass das ArcGIS-Server-Konto Zugriff auf das Verzeichnis hat.
- Geben Sie für Variablenname den Namen sdeinterceptloc ein.
- Geben Sie für den Variablenwert den Wert C:\temp\sde_client ein.
- Klicken Sie auf OK, und schließen Sie die Fenster Systemeigenschaften und Erweiterte Systemeinstellungen.
- Starten Sie den ArcGIS-Server-Service über das Verzeichnis mit den Windows-Services neu.
- Reproduzieren Sie den Fehler oder das Problem.
- Navigieren Sie zu dem in Schritt 4 (ii) angegebenen Verzeichnis, und überprüfen Sie die erstellten sde_client-Dateien.
- Wiederholen Sie nach Abschluss der Diagnose die Schritte 1 und 2, und löschen Sie die in den Schritten 3 und 4 erstellten Variablen in der Liste Systemvariable.